An island range hood can be connected to an external venting system that will exhaust the cooking vapors through a duct to the outside or it can utilize recirculating filters to sieve the odors and airborne grease out of your kitchen. It's crucial to select a venting option that will be compatible with your home and kitchen remodeling plans, as a malfunctioning setup can lead to airborne grease build-up, sound, and electrical problems in the future. Island hood filters are an essential part of the overall functioning of your range hood, and you will need to change them on a regular basis to ensure that the hood continues to carry out correctly. Grease can construct up on the filter, causing it to become blocked and even to begin leaking onto the range and countertops. Cleaning the filter frequently assists to keep it in great condition. There are numerous different kinds of hood filters, including stainless steel baffle filters that trap grease particles mechanically and are dishwashing machine safe. You can also get multiple-use charcoal filters that require to be cleaned up every 2-3 months. These filters are typically less costly and can be used with ducted or recirculating island hoods. For a more eco-friendly alternative, you can likewise buy a ceramic filter that uses very high purification and deodorization performance levels and requires regular heat regeneration to keep it in great condition. However, it's best to seek advice from the producer of your hood to discover out which kind of filter is the most proper for it.
